Ourlads' Profile:

2026 Guide: What Ourlads’ NFL Scouting Services said about KADYN PROCTOR:

Alabama | Hometown: Des Moines, IA | HT: 6064 | WT: 358 | 40 time: 5.21 | Hand: 0978 | Arm: 3338 | Wing: 8038

Three year starter. Proctor is among the most intriguing prospects in this draft class. In 2025, Proctor was named as a consensus All-American and first-team All-SEC. An early commit to Iowa, he flipped to Alabama prior to the 2023 season, then transferred back to Iowa in 2024 before transferring back to Alabama. Whew! A starter at the top collegiate level since day one, his future lies ahead of him. His reach and size are a cut above all, he has unusually good knee bend for a big man. Light on his feet and has an aggressive temperament. Has impressive quickness for a big man. Just how talented is this guy, this past season he carried the ball as a running back and caught a pass on a screen play. Nasty is a good description of his playing attitude. His long reach allows him a great cushion in pass protection. His excellent knee bend allows him to sink as a finishing touch to his pass protection skills. His foot speed allows him to widen and climb in the power running game. When his opponent is square to him, it's no contest. After a slow start to the season, his game has been on an upward rise. Appears to be very coachable because of this progress. His pad level rises as the game goes on, and like most big guys, needs to work on his hand placement. Will need to work on conditioning his body for the long haul in NFL football. Needs to work on shadowing the defensive end on inside moves. The added polish needed at the next level will be attainable with his natural skill set. He will be an anchor left tackle at the next level with his continued development, but a move to guard may not be out of the question. Should be one of several offensive tackles taken in the first round.
